Le blog francophone consacré
aux technologies Esri

Mise à jour d'ArcGIS Experience Builder - Mars 2023

Avec la mise à jour d'ArcGIS Online en février 2023, le générateur d'applications ArcGIS Experience Builder a été également été actualisé. Esri a introduit de nouvelles fonctionnalités pour vous aider à créer facilement des applications et des pages web sans le moindre développement. Depuis quelques jours, ArcGIS Experience Builder Developer Edition est également disponible pour une installation et une personnalisation du générateur d'applications dans votre propre infrastructure.
 

Parmi les principales nouveautés, Esri a ajouté le widget "Ajouter des données" et l'outil "Coupe" est dans le widget "Boîte à outils 3D". Parmi les autres améliorations attendues, on pourra citer la possibilité de choisir les couches à afficher dans le widget "Couches cartographiques", la prise en charge par les utilisateurs finaux de la définition d'emplacements ou de géographies pour les infographies dans le widget "Business Analyst", la prise en charge de l'affichage des lignes de profil d'élévation pour les couches de maillage 3D et de nouveaux histogrammes. Explorons ces fonctionnalités.


Widget "Ajouter des données"

Le widget Ajouter des données vous permet d'ajouter des données à la volée via du contenu ArcGIS, une URL ou des fichiers locaux.


Actuellement, les fichiers Shapefile, CSV et GeoJSON peuvent être téléchargés, et les types d'URL pris en charge sont les suivants :


On notera également que la taille du fichier et le nombre d'enregistrements que vous pouvez télécharger sont limités. Par exemple, les fichiers CSV sont limités à un maximum de 1000 enregistrements. Voir cette page sur le widget "Ajouter des données" pour plus d'informations.

Pour ajouter automatiquement des données à la carte comme indiqué ci-dessus, vous pourrez utiliser le message "Données ajoutées" du widget pour déclencher l'action "Ajouter à la carte" ou encore "Zoom sur".


Les utilisateurs finaux pourront également exécuter des opérations comme filtrer les données qu'ils viennent d'ajouter, les exporter vers différents formats CSV, JSON ou GeoJSON ou encore afficher la table attributaire dans le widget "Table" (si ce dernier est présent dans la page).




Améliorations

Widget "Couches cartographiques"

Parfois, il peut ne pas être approprié d'afficher toutes les couches dans le widget "couches cartographiques". Vous pouvez maintenant choisir les couches à afficher dans le widget avec le paramètre "Personnaliser les couches".


Diagrammes

Le nouvel histogramme est approprié pour montrer la distribution. Pour créer des histogrammes, vous devez utiliser des données prenant en charge les centiles. En savoir plus sur les propriétés des couches.


Business Analyst

Le widget "Business Analyst" n'est plus en version bêta avec un nombre important de nouvelles fonctionnalités. Par exemple, il dispose désormais de deux modes : "Processus" et "Prédéfini". 


Le premier, illustré ci-dessous, fournit aux utilisateurs finaux des panneaux étape par étape pour définir un emplacement ou une géographie et exécuter une infographie. Ce dernier embarque une infographie avec des paramètres préconfigurés.


Le widget "Business Analyst" peut également interagir avec d'autres widgets, notamment Liste, Table, Recherche et Carte. Par exemple, dans l'animation ci-dessous, la sélection d'un nom de canton dans la liste déclenche automatiquement une mise à jour dynamique de l'infographie.


Pour une liste complète des améliorations ajoutées dans cette version, consultez cet article de la communauté Esri.

Profil d'élévation

Avec le widget "Profil d'élévation", vous pouvez désormais afficher des couches de scènes, des couches de photomaillage et des couches avec des symboles 3D dans des scènes Web. L'exemple suivant affiche les lignes de profil d'élévation pour le sol et les bâtiments.


Pour générer un profil d'élévation pour les bâtiments, activez l'option "Afficher dans le diagramme" sous "Objets volumétriques" dans les paramètres du profil et personnalisez l'étiquette.


De plus, vous pouvez utiliser la nouvelle action de message "Sélectionner une ligne" pour faire interagir le widget Profil d'élévation avec d'autres widgets.


Dans l'exemple suivant, la sélection d'une entité linéaire dans la table génère un profil. En outre, le widget génère une source de données de sortie que d'autres widgets peuvent utiliser. Par exemple, vous pouvez afficher dynamiquement les valeurs de distance et d'élévation maximales dans le widget "Texte" lorsqu'un nouveau profil est généré.


Boîte à outils 3D

Avec le nouvel outil "Coupe", vous pouvez découper une couche, telle qu'un entrepôt, de haut en bas pour révéler les entités à l'intérieur d'un bâtiment, comme illustré ci-dessous. Vous pouvez également le couper horizontalement selon n'importe quel angle.


Grille

Certains d'entre vous aimeraient organiser les éléments de la grille avant d'ajouter des widgets. Vous pouvez maintenant le faire facilement avec les nouveaux boutons "Fractionner verticalement" et "Fractionner horizontalement".


Modèles

Cinq nouveaux modèles ont été introduit :


Vous pouvez les trouver en recherchant le badge "Nouveau" sur leurs vignettes dans la bibliothèque de modèles.

  • Brochure (plein écran) se concentre sur la carte, naviguant sur les cartes pour émuler le feuilletage d'une brochure.
  • Planche d'avatars (grille) a plusieurs cartes avec des effets de survol et de retournement.
  • Prospectus (grille) affiche les coordonnées et les informations de localisation à partir d'une carte.
  • Dépliant (grille) affiche du texte et des images dans plusieurs colonnes.
  • Montage (grille) entoure un sujet avec plusieurs images.


De plus, le widget "Traçage de réseau de distribution" n'est plus en version bêta. Pour plus d'informations, consultez Nouveautés du générateur d'expérience. 


Experience Builder Developer Edition

La version 1.11 de l'édition développeur d'ArcGIS Experience Builder est désormais disponible sur le site web ArcGIS for Developers, aidant les développeurs à créer et à étendre leurs applications Web sans code (ou peu de code) beaucoup plus rapidement.

Pour les développeurs, en plus d'intégrer les nouvelles fonctionnalités évoquées précédemment dans cet article, la version 1.11 ajoute un nouveau composant "Sélection avancée" dans l'interface de conception d'interface utilisateur Storybook.

Tableau des versions

ArcGIS Experience Builder est fourni avec ArcGIS Online, ArcGIS Enterprise et l'édition développeur. Les dernières fonctionnalités sont d'abord disponibles dans ArcGIS Online, puis récupérées par l'édition développeur trois à quatre semaines plus tard. Les deux ont trois versions chaque année. Experience Builder dans ArcGIS Enterprise propose deux versions par an et reprend les fonctionnalités d'ArcGIS Online.

Lorsque vous ajoutez des widgets personnalisés à ArcGIS Enterprise pour étendre Experience Builder dans ArcGIS Enterprise, ce tableau devient pratique. Il vous aide à prendre des décisions sur la version de l'édition développeur que vous devez utiliser pour créer des widgets personnalisés compatibles avec la version d'ArcGIS Enterprise sur laquelle vous allez les déployer. Si votre personnalisation utilise ArcGIS Maps SDK for Javascript, la règle d'or est que vous devez toujours choisir la version de l'édition développeur qui utilise la même version d'ArcGIS Maps SDK for JavaScript dans ArcGIS Enterprise. Dans l'exemple ci-dessous, la version 1.8 de l'édition développeur doit être utilisée pour créer des widgets personnalisés ajoutés à ArcGIS Enterprise 11.0.


Vous pouvez contacter l'équipe Experience Builder via cette adresse email experiencebuilder@esri.com si vous avez des questions.

Partager cet article:

Rejoindre la discussion

    Les commentaires à propos de cet article:

3 comments :

Unknown a dit…

Bonjour,
Il est indiqué "Pour une liste complète des améliorations ajoutées dans cette version, consultez cet article de la communauté Esri." concernant le widget "Business Analyst" mais il n'y a pas le lien...

Gaëtan Lavenu a dit…

Bonjour,

Le lien a été ajouté. Merci pour votre retour.

Unknown a dit…

Merci !